[ad_1]
Memcached 是一个强大的缓存系统,可以提高网站速度和性能。 它可以与 PHP 一起使用, Apache、NGINX 等流行平台。 以下是安装 memcached 的步骤 Apache 对于 Ubuntu、CentOS。 您还可以使用它们在 WordPress、Drupal、Magento 中安装 memcached。
如何安装 memcached Apache
我们将看看如何在 Ubuntu 和 CentOS 中安装 memcached。 以下步骤也将在安装后启用 memcached。
在 Ubuntu 中安装 memcached
打开终端并运行以下命令来更新包
$ sudo apt-get update
安装 memcached 及其依赖项
$ sudo apt-get install php-memcached memcached
重新开始 Apache 应用更改的 Web 服务器
$ sudo service restart apache2
奖励阅读:如何在 Ubuntu 中安装 mod_session
在 CentOS 中安装 memcached
打开终端并运行以下命令进行安装 内存缓存 及其依赖项。
# yum clean all # yum -y update # yum -y install memcached php-memcached
这将安装 memcached,但不会使其在启动时运行。
systemctl start memcached systemctl enable memcached systemctl status memcached
重新开始 Apache 应用更改的 Web 服务器。
sudo systemctl restart httpd.service
奖励阅读:如何禁用 mod_security Apache
验证内存缓存
为确保安装并启用了 memcached,请创建一个包含以下内容的测试文件 /var/www/html/test.php。
<?php $mem = new Memcached(); $mem->addServer("127.0.0.1", 11211); $result = $mem->get("blah"); if ($result) { echo $result; } else { echo "No matching key found yet"; $mem->set("blah", "Data from memcached") or die("Couldn't save anything to memcached..."); } ?>
Save 和 close 文件。 打开浏览器并转到 https://IP_OF_SERVER/test.php
将 IP_OF_SERVER 替换为您服务器的 IP 或域名。
第一次,您将看到消息“尚未找到匹配的密钥”。 在浏览器上刷新页面。 这一次,您将看到消息“Data from memcached”
希望上面的文章能帮助你安装和配置 memcached Apache 适用于 Ubuntu 和 CentOS。
[ad_2]